Workspace Preparation and Safety Guidelines
Preparing your workspace and ensuring safety is crucial before embarking on a bathtub and shower refinishing project. Proper preparation is crucial for a successful refinishing project. Ensure the workspace is safe and clean to avoid any accidents during the process.
Remove all items from the bathtub and shower area.
Clean the surfaces thoroughly with a non-abrasive cleaner to remove soap scum and grime.
Sand the surfaces with medium-grit sandpaper to create a rough texture for better paint adhesion.
Rinse and dry the surfaces completely to eliminate any dust or debris.
Wear safety goggles and a respirator mask during sanding and painting to protect against harmful particles and fumes. Ensure the area is well-ventilated.
Refinishing Process Execution Steps

Executing the refinishing process requires attention to detail to ensure a long-lasting finish. Follow these steps carefully for the best results.
Tape off edges using masking tape to protect surrounding areas from paint.
Apply primer from the refinishing kit using a roller for large areas and a brush for corners.
Allow primer to dry according to the manufacturer’s instructions.
Sand the primed surface lightly with fine-grit sandpaper to smooth any imperfections.
Clean the surface again to remove dust from sanding.
Apply the topcoat using the same method as the primer. Use multiple thin coats for even coverage.
Allow the topcoat to cure fully before using the bathtub or shower.
Common Mistakes to Avoid

Avoiding common pitfalls can save time and improve the quality of your refinishing job. Be mindful of these issues.
Skipping surface preparation can lead to poor adhesion.
Using thick coats of paint may result in drips and uneven surfaces.
Ignoring drying times can compromise the finish quality.
